X-Git-Url: https://git.sesse.net/?a=blobdiff_plain;f=plugins%2Fmacosx%2FMakefile;h=42b2fd4f5b4d653cb84e409ea1dac9581f4e28ec;hb=89be0ac8de8e3684cce4c7a697525e949e19b3de;hp=9807575c6c5ce2331de2ebacb208018c8f4ddf51;hpb=6b3c854071c43c099f55c5c61731e59999239854;p=vlc diff --git a/plugins/macosx/Makefile b/plugins/macosx/Makefile index 9807575c6c..42b2fd4f5b 100644 --- a/plugins/macosx/Makefile +++ b/plugins/macosx/Makefile @@ -1,54 +1 @@ -############################################################################### -# vlc (VideoLAN Client) macosx module makefile -# (c)2001 VideoLAN -############################################################################### - -include ../../Makefile.modules - -############################################################################### -# Objects and files -############################################################################### -PLUGIN_MACOSX = macosx.o intf_macosx.o aout_macosx.o vout_macosx.o -BUILTIN_MACOSX = $(PLUGIN_MACOSX:%.o=%-BUILTIN.o) - -ALL_OBJ = $(PLUGIN_MACOSX) $(BUILTIN_MACOSX) - -objects := $(PLUGIN_MACOSX) $(BUILTIN_MACOSX) -cdependancies := $(objects:%.o=.dep/%.d) - -export - -# -# Virtual targets -# -all: - -clean: - rm -f $(ALL_OBJ) - rm -f *.o *.moc *.bak *.so *.a *.builtin - rm -rf .dep - -FORCE: - -$(cdependancies): %.d: FORCE - @$(MAKE) -s --no-print-directory -f ../../Makefile.dep $@ - -$(ALL_OBJ): %.o: ../../Makefile.dep - -$(PLUGIN_MACOSX): %.o: .dep/%.d -$(PLUGIN_MACOSX): %.o: %.c - $(CC) $(CFLAGS) $(PCFLAGS) -fpascal-strings -c -o $@ $< - -$(BUILTIN_MACOSX): %-BUILTIN.o: .dep/%.d -$(BUILTIN_MACOSX): %-BUILTIN.o: %.c - $(CC) $(CFLAGS) -DBUILTIN -fpascal-strings -c -o $@ $< - -# -# Real targets -# -../../lib/macosx.so: $(PLUGIN_MACOSX) - $(CC) $(PCFLAGS) -o $@ $^ $(PLCFLAGS) -framework CoreAudio -framework Carbon -framework AGL - -../../lib/macosx.a: $(BUILTIN_MACOSX) - ar r $@ $^ - +macosx_SOURCES = macosx.c aout_macosx.c vout_macosx.c vout_window.c vout_qdview.c intf_macosx.c intf_controller.c intf_vlc_wrapper.c